Knowledge Base Guide
Overview
The knowledge base is built from:
- Journals - Your entries and team entries
- Task history - Past tasks, decisions, outcomes
- Messages - Channel discussions
- Documentation - Produced docs
All content is embedded (vectorized) for semantic search.
Searching the Knowledge Base
Search Your Journal
roboco_journal_search(
query="rate limiting redis implementation",
top_k=5 # Number of results
)
Returns semantically similar entries - not just keyword matches.

Reading Past Work
Your Recent Entries
roboco_journal_recent(limit=10)
roboco_journal_recent(entry_type="decision_log")
roboco_journal_recent(task_id="uuid-here")
Your Stats
roboco_journal_stats()
# Returns: entries by type, growth metrics, top tags
Team Journals (if you have access)
roboco_journal_read_team(
target_agent="be-dev-1",
task_id="uuid-here", # Filter by task
entry_type="decision_log", # Filter by type
limit=10
)
Check Your Access Scope
roboco_journal_scope()
# Returns: your role, cell, who you can read
Before Starting a Task
Always search first:
# 1. Search for similar past work
roboco_journal_search("implementing rate limiter")
# 2. Check if someone documented this before
roboco_journal_search("rate limit decisions")
# 3. Look for learnings
roboco_journal_search("rate limiting lessons learned")
This helps you:
- Avoid repeating mistakes
- Find proven patterns
- Learn from others' experiences
- Understand past decisions
Contributing to Knowledge Base
Everything you journal becomes searchable:
| Entry Type | Searchable Content |
|---|---|
| Decision Log | Context, options, rationale |
| Learning | What learned, how applied |
| Struggle | Problem, solutions, resolution |
| Reflection | What done, what learned, struggles |
| General | Title, content, tags |
Pro tip: Use descriptive titles and tags - they improve search relevance.

Best Practices
- Search before you start - Learn from past work
- Journal as you go - Don't wait until end
- Be specific - Generic entries are less searchable
- Use tags - Helps categorization
- Record failures - They're valuable learning
- Include context - Future searchers need it
